With two water bottle holders, a small pocket on the front, a roomy main compartment, and of course, a padded laptop zippered compartment, it made for a great carry-on bag for a six-hour flight.
When I got caught in the rain, the quick-drying and water-resistant vinyl kept my computer safe. And when I bought too many books on vacation, it held them all nicely and still gave me room for other odds and ends. You can find Fjallraven backpacks in a bunch of colors (and you can get this same style in smaller sizes), but the 17-inch has comfortably fit two of my laptops at the same time in the little pouch. Overall, it’s spacious enough for ample packing without feeling like a giant piece of luggage and frankly, it just looks really cool.
Whether you travel a lot, commute daily or just find yourself often leaving the house with a computer or tablet — upgrading to a backpack with a whole extra zippered section can make your whole day run smoother. And it doesn’t have to break the bank.
